Below are popular ashirwad (blessing) mantras with their Sanskrit text and meanings, commonly found in free resources like Manblunder 1. Universal Well-being Mantra (Sarve Bhavantu Sukhinah)

This is one of the most common mantras recited at the end of prayers to wish for the happiness of all living beings.

सर्वे भवन्तु सुखिनः सर्वे सन्तु निरामयाः।

सर्वे भद्राणि पश्यन्तु मा कश्चिद्दुःखभाग्भवेत्।

ॐ शान्तिः शान्तिः शान्तिः॥ Transliteration:

Sarve bhavantu sukhinaḥ sarve santu nirāmayāḥ | Sarve bhadrāṇi paśyantu mā kaścidduḥkhabhāgbhavet | Oṃ śāntiḥ śāntiḥ śāntiḥ ||

May all be happy. May all be free from illness. May all see what is auspicious. May no one suffer. Om Peace, Peace, Peace. 2. Vedic Blessing for Long Life (Shatamanam Bhavati)

Often chanted by elders or priests during birthdays or weddings to bless a person with a long, healthy life.

शतमानीं भवति शतायुः पुरुषः शतेन्द्रियः। Transliteration:

Śatamānaṃ bhavati śatāyuḥ puruṣaḥ śatendriyaḥ |

May you live for a hundred years with a hundred healthy senses and a healthy life. 3. Shanti Path (Yajurveda Peace Mantra) Ashirwad Mantra Sanskrit Pdf Free

This mantra is recited to bring peace to all elements of nature and the universe. Green Message

ॐ द्यौ: शान्तिरन्तरिक्षँ शान्ति: पृथ्वी शान्तिराप: शान्तिरोषधय: शान्ति:।

वनस्पतय: शान्तिर्विश्वे देवा: शान्तिर्ब्रह्म शान्ति: सर्वँ शान्ति: शान्तिरेव शान्ति: सा मा शान्तिरेधि॥ Transliteration:

Oṃ dyauḥ śāntir-antarikṣaṃ śāntiḥ pṛthivī śāntir-āpaḥ śāntir-oṣadhayaḥ śāntiḥ | Vanaspatayaḥ śāntir-viśvedevāḥ śāntir-brahma śāntiḥ sarvaṃ śāntiḥ śāntireva śāntiḥ sā mā śāntiredhi ||

May peace radiate in the sky and space. May peace reign on earth, in water, in plants, and in trees. May peace flow through the universe and the Supreme Being. May there be peace everywhere. Green Message 4. Short Sanskrit Blessing Phrases These are quick one-line blessings used in daily life: Ayushman Bhava / Chiranjeevi Bhava: May you live a long life. Vijayee Bhava: May you be victorious. Yashasvi Bhava: May you be glorious and successful. Saubhagyamastu: May you be blessed with good fortune. Kalyanamastu: May auspicious things happen to you. This verse is often used during ceremonies to bless an individual with a lifespan of 100 years and the fulfillment of all worldly needs. Sanskrit:

ॐ शतमानं भवति शतायुः पुरुषः शतेन्द्रिय आयुष्येवेन्द्रिये प्रतितिष्ठति । Transliteration:

Om śatamānaṃ bhavati śatāyuḥ puruṣaḥ śatendriya āyuṣyevendriye pratitiṣṭhati . English Meaning:

May you live for a hundred years (shata-ayush), with a hundred senses (full health), and may you be established in that long life and strength. II. The Mangala Mantra (Blessing for Universal Peace)

Recited at the end of many Vedic rituals to ensure the welfare of the surroundings and the individual. Sanskrit:

स्वस्ति प्रजाभ्यः परिपालयन्तां न्यायेन मार्गेण महीं महीशाः ।गोब्राह्मणेभ्यः शुभमस्तु नित्यं लोकाः समस्ताः सुखिनो भवन्तु ॥ Transliteration:

Svasti prajābhyaḥ paripālayantāṃ nyāyena mārgeṇa mahīṃ mahīśāḥ |Go-brāhmaṇebhyaḥ śubhamastu nityaṃ lokāḥ samastāḥ sukhino bhavantu || English Meaning:

May there be well-being for the people; may the rulers protect the earth through the path of justice. May there be good for the cows and the learned, and may all beings everywhere be happy. III. The Dashain/Traditional Victory Blessing When searching for religious texts or mantras, you
